Key Features

The MMBT4403WT1 offers several performance advantages including a low VCE(sat) of 0.5V maximum at 500mA, ensuring efficient switching operation. Its transition frequency of 200MHz makes it suitable for moderate-speed applications. The device maintains stable characteristics across a -55°C to +150°C junction temperature range. Notable electrical characteristics include a collector-emitter breakdown voltage of 40V and emitter-base breakdown voltage of 6V. The transistor's Pb-free construction meets RoHS compliance requirements, and its moisture sensitivity level (MSL) rating of 1 makes it suitable for standard surface-mount assembly processes without special handling precautions.

Application Areas

This transistor finds widespread use in load switching circuits for peripherals in consumer electronics, where its low saturation voltage minimizes power loss. It serves as interface drivers in microcontroller circuits, small signal amplifiers in audio stages, and as building blocks in logic level converters. Industrial applications include sensor signal conditioning, relay drivers, and power management circuits. The automotive sector utilizes the MMBT4403WT1 in non-critical electronic modules where its temperature stability and reliability meet basic requirements. Its cost-performance ratio makes it particularly popular in high-volume manufacturing of electronic assemblies.

Proper handling of the MMBT4403WT1 involves standard ESD precautions during assembly, despite its relatively robust construction. Designers should ensure the maximum ratings (especially VCEO and IC) are not exceeded in the application circuit, with appropriate derating for elevated temperature operation. For reliability, the device should not be operated in its breakdown region, and base current should be properly limited through series resistors. PCB layout should provide adequate clearance between terminals to prevent solder bridging, and reflow profiles should follow JEDEC J-STD-020 guidelines for lead-free components to prevent thermal damage during assembly.

B2B Procurement Guide

When sourcing MMBT4403WT1 transistors, verify manufacturer authenticity through authorized distributors to avoid counterfeit components. Volume pricing typically breaks at 1k, 10k, and 100k unit quantities, with tape-and-reel packaging offering the best value for automated assembly. Key procurement considerations include checking current production status (active/non-active), lead time variations (typically 8-12 weeks for large orders), and alternative part numbers for second-source options. Quality-conscious buyers should request certificates of compliance and consider lot traceability requirements. For prototyping or small batches, sample quantities are often available through distributor evaluation programs.
